EASY BANANA ICE CREAM (TIPS + 10 FLAVORS!)

Steps:
- Be sure to start with ripe and spotty bananas. Peel and slice into 1/2-inch slices for easier blending (large chunks tax the motor). Then add to a parchment-lined baking sheet and freeze until firm (3-4 hours or overnight).
- Add sliced frozen bananas to a food processor fitted with an "S" blade. Then blend for 4-5 minutes or until completely smooth, fluffy, and blended. You'll need to stop occasionally to stir and scrape the sides. You'll be left with a soft serve texture. See "FREEZING" below for freezing tips.
- Add sliced frozen bananas to a high-speed blender, our most recommended model being the Vitamix 5200 for ultimate control and its powerful motor. (The Kitchenaid KSB8270FP Pro Line Series works well, too.) Turn the Vitamix dial to its lowest setting and ensure the switch is flipped to "Variable" NOT "High" to start with. It's too much to jump the motor from 0-100 that fast.
- Once it's started blending, quickly switch from "Variable" to "High" speed and use the tamper to press down and stir/agitate the bananas, which should turn into soft-serve texture banana ice cream quite quickly. If the motor seems to be struggling, stop and pause momentarily. Be sure to switch back to low speed / "Variable," then switch to "High" speed every time to protect the motor.
- Adding flavor to your nice cream is easy! For every flavor besides strawberry, berry, or Salted Caramel, simply add the recommended amounts of each ingredient to your ice cream at this time and blend until creamy and smooth, scraping down the sides as needed. If making strawberry or berry, we recommend adding them at the beginning with the unblended bananas for best texture.
- At this point you have soft-serve texture banana ice cream. To get more of a scoopable ice cream texture, simply spread into a Tupperware or parchment-lined loaf pan and freeze for 2-3 hours. Then scoop with an ice cream scoop! If too firm, let thaw 15-30 minutes to soften.
- Best when fresh. See freezing instructions above. Frozen banana ice cream should keep for up to 1 month if well covered, though we find it's best when used within the first week.

BANANA ICE CREAM TOPPING
My home recipe for warm bananas to top your bowl of ice cream. You get the perfect mixture between hot and cold.

Steps:
- Place bananas in a saucepan over high heat; cook and stir until bananas become a chunky paste, about 5 minutes. Turn temperature down to medium, and mix brown sugar, milk, cinnamon, and vanilla extract into saucepan. Stir until all ingredients are well combined, about 5 minutes.

QUICK BANANA ICE CREAM
A no-churn ice cream that's low-fat, superhealthy and counts as one of your five-a-day

Steps:
- Pop the banana chunks on a flat tray and cover well. Freeze for at least 1 hr, or until frozen through. When ready to eat throw the banana into a food processor and whizz until smooth with enough of the milk to achieve a creamy texture. Scoop into 4 bowls or glasses, then top with the sauce and nuts.

CARAMELIZED BANANA ICE CREAM - ONCE UPON A CHEF

- Slice the bananas into 1/2-inch pieces and toss them with the brown sugar and butter in a 2-quart baking dish until the sugar dissolves into a wet caramel-colored coating. Bake for about 40 minutes, stirring once during baking, until the bananas are soft and golden brown.
- Immediately transfer the bananas and caramel syrup into a blender or food processor (if you wait too long, the caramel will begin to harden). Add the milk, granulated sugar, vanilla, lemon juice and salt, and purée until smooth. Chill the mixture thoroughly in the refrigerator.
- Give the mixture a quick whisk, then freeze in ice cream machine according to manufacturer's instructions. Transfer soft ice cream to plastic container and chill for a few hours until firm. Scoop and serve.
